Transaction 63de1d3524d7434b8b3d13b59b207ae2612169f44358b67d088ea8e3c139ac60

5 Input
2 Outputs
  • 63de1d3524d7434b8b3d13b59b207ae2612169f44358b67d088ea8e3c139ac60:0
  • value  5680983
    address  1JfSfYrTwgzAtjsiJ4Ldt9REs5SvAoBeaL
  • 63de1d3524d7434b8b3d13b59b207ae2612169f44358b67d088ea8e3c139ac60:1
  • value  79397108
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n